What do the terms par (face) value, coupon, and maturity date mean for bonds?

face value is what is the value of the bond when you buy it. coupon rate is how much interest you earn on that bond over a period of time. selling price depends on the yield to maturity of the bond.

Par is the original price of the bond, coupon is the interest rate, maturity date is the date the bond will be turned back into cash
